WebMay 27, 2024 · PURPOSE To develop a clinical practice guideline for systemic antifungal prophylaxis in pediatric patients with cancer and hematopoietic stem-cell transplantation (HSCT) recipients. METHODS Recommendations were developed by an international multidisciplinary panel that included a patient advocate. Review of how existing pediatric cancer clinical trial groups internationally have been formed and how … WebJan 5, 2024 · Cancer is a major cause of pediatric mortality. In the US, cancer is the second most common cause of death among children 1 to 14 years old (surpassed only by accidents) and is the fourth most common cause of death among adolescents 15 to 19 years old.
